History | Log In     View a printable version of the current page.  
Issue Details (XML | Word | Printable)

Key: RSPL-122
Type: Exception Exception
Status: Closed Closed
Resolution: Fixed
Priority: Normal Normal
Assignee: Alexander Nesterenko
Reporter: Magnus Olsson
Votes: 0
Watchers: 1
Operations

If you were logged in you would be able to see more operations.
ReSharper Plugins

at CollectionUtil.GetFirst : Cannot get the first element in the collection because the collection is empty.

Created: 02 Apr 08 12:57   Updated: 04 Apr 08 12:09
Component/s: SafeDevelop - RGreatEx
Fix Version/s: None
Security Level: Everybody (All jira users)

Original Estimate: Unknown Remaining Estimate: Unknown Time Spent: Unknown

Build: 767


 Description  « Hide
Previous exception:RSRP-63437
ReSharper 4 Version=4.0.767.22, Edition=, Built=2008-04-01T21:16:50, Configuration=ReSharper_AddIn, VsVersion=9.0
JetBrains.Util.LoggerException: Cannot get the first element in the collection because the collection is empty. ---> System.InvalidOperationException: Cannot get the first element in the collection because the collection is empty.
at JetBrains.Util.CollectionUtil.GetFirst[T](IEnumerable`1 c) in c:\Agent\work\39db43b25bc9fc32\Platform\src\Util\src\Collections\CollectionUtil.cs:line 345
at SafeDevelop.RGreatEx.Resources.SmartSuggestionsCreator.GetResult(ICollection`1 allSuggestions, ICollection`1 userSuggestions)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SmartSuggestionsCreator.cs:line 59
at SafeDevelop.RGreatEx.Resources.SmartSuggestionsCreator.GetSuggestions(String value)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SmartSuggestionsCreator.cs:line 40
at SafeDevelop.RGreatEx.Resources.SuggestionsCreatorBase.GetSuggestionsFromString(IExpression stringLiteral)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SuggestionsCreatorBase.cs:line 166
at SafeDevelop.RGreatEx.Resources.SuggestionsCreatorBase.GetPropertyNameSuggestions(IExpression stringLiteral)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SuggestionsCreatorBase.cs:line 104
at SafeDevelop.RGreatEx.Resources.SmartSuggestionsCreator.GetAllSuggestions(IEnumerable`1 expressions)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SmartSuggestionsCreator.cs:line 106
at SafeDevelop.RGreatEx.Resources.SmartSuggestionsCreator.Process(ICollection`1 expressions)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SmartSuggestionsCreator.cs:line 33
at SafeDevelop.RGreatEx.Resources.SuggestionsCreatorBase.GetSuggestions(ICollection`1 expressions)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x.Resources\SuggestionsCreatorBase.cs:line 64
at SafeDevelop.RGreatEx.UI.Refactoring.MoveStringToResource.FromScope.SecondPage.Initialize(IProgressIndicator progressIndicator) in d:\Repository\SafeDevelop\Projects\RGreatEx\4.0\1.1.4\SafeDevelop.RGreatEx\UI\Refactoring\MoveStringToResource\FromScope\SecondPage.cs:line 140
at JetBrains.ReSharper.Refactorings.Workflow.WorkflowProcessor.CustomPageInitializer.Initialize(IProgressIndicator progressIndicator)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\WorkflowProcessor.cs:line 697
— End of inner exception stack trace —

at JetBrains.ReSharper.Refactorings.Workflow.CustomPageInitializer.Initialize(IProgressIndicator)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\WorkflowProcessor.cs:line 707 column 11
at JetBrains.ReSharper.Refactorings.Workflow.TaskHelper.Run() in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\RefactoringsTaskExecutor.cs:line 211 column 15
at JetBrains.ReSharper.Refactorings.Workflow.RefactoringsTaskExecutor.DoRun(TaskHelper)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\RefactoringsTaskExecutor.cs:line 313 column 5
at JetBrains.ReSharper.Refactorings.Workflow.<>c_DisplayClass1.<ExecuteTask>b_0() in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\RefactoringsTaskExecutor.cs:line 126 column 15
at JetBrains.Application.LockInvocator.Execute(Action) in c:\Agent\work\39db43b25bc9fc32\Platform\src\Shell\src\Threading\LockInvocator.cs:line 171 column 6
at JetBrains.Application.LockInvocator.Call(Action, Purpose) in c:\Agent\work\39db43b25bc9fc32\Platform\src\Shell\src\Threading\LockInvocator.cs:line 120 column 3
at JetBrains.Application.LockInvocator.CallForWriting(Action) in c:\Agent\work\39db43b25bc9fc32\Platform\src\Shell\src\Threading\LockInvocator.cs:line 271 column 3
at JetBrains.ReSharper.Refactorings.Workflow.RefactoringsTaskExecutor.ExecuteTask(TaskHelper, String, Boolean, Boolean&)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\RefactoringsTaskExecutor.cs:line 136 column 7
at JetBrains.ReSharper.Refactorings.Workflow.RefactoringsTaskExecutor.ExecuteTask(TaskWithProgress, String, Boolean&)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\RefactoringsTaskExecutor.cs:line 142 column 7
at JetBrains.ReSharper.Refactorings.Workflow.TaskExecutorWrapper.ExecuteTask(TaskWithProgress, String, Boolean&)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\WorkflowProcessor.cs:line 788 column 9
at JetBrains.ReSharper.Refactorings.Workflow.WorkflowProcessor.ShowNextPage() in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\WorkflowProcessor.cs:line 440 column 17
at JetBrains.ReSharper.Refactorings.Workflow.WorkflowProcessor.MyForm_OnContinueClicked(Object, EventArgs)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\Workflow\WorkflowProcessor.cs:line 360 column 5
at JetBrains.ReSharper.Refactorings.Workflow.WinForms.RefactoringWizardForm.myContinueButton_Click(Object, EventArgs) in c:\Agent\work\39db43b25bc9fc32\src\NewRefactorings\src\WorkflowW\RefactoringWizardForm.cs:line 482 column 6
at System.Windows.Forms.Control.OnClick(EventArgs)
at System.Windows.Forms.Button.OnClick(EventArgs)
at System.Windows.Forms.Button.OnMouseUp(MouseEventArgs)
at System.Windows.Forms.Control.WmMouseUp(Message&, MouseButtons, Int32)
at System.Windows.Forms.Control.WndProc(Message&)
at System.Windows.Forms.ButtonBase.WndProc(Message&)
at System.Windows.Forms.Button.WndProc(Message&)
at System.Windows.Forms.ControlNativeWindow.OnMessage(Message&)
at System.Windows.Forms.ControlNativeWindow.WndProc(Message&)
at System.Windows.Forms.NativeWindow.DebuggableCallback(IntPtr, Int32, IntPtr, IntPtr)



 All   Comments   Work Log   Change History      Sort Order:
Alexander Nesterenko - 04 Apr 08 12:09
Fixed in the RGreatEx 1.1.5